Villa Kleber

All Star
Strasbourg, France

About This Hotel

Villa Kleber is located in Strasbourg, 500 metres from Strasbourg Christmas Market. The Petite France is 600 metres from the property. . The accommodation has a satellite flat-screen TV. A refrigerator and coffee machine are also offered. There is a private bathroom with a shower in every unit. Towels and bed linen are featured. Strasbourg Cathedral is 700 metres from Villa Kleber, while Strasburg History Museum is 800 metres away. The nearest airport is Strasbourg International Airport, 10 km from Villa Kleber. Please inform Villa Kleber in advance of your expected arrival time. You can use the Special Requests box when booking, or contact the property directly with the contact details provided in your confirmation. Payment before arrival via bank transfer is required. The property will contact you after you book to provide instructions. Managed by a private host

Facilities & Amenities

Non-smoking rooms
Family rooms internet services wifi
Free
WiFi wifi available in all areas

Location

Lat: 48.5860100, Lng: 7.7437700
Open in OSM